SPORTING

VINCENT JOCKEY CLUB

(By Telegraph—Press Association.)

OMAKAU, This Day

The Aveather is overcast and the attendance good, and tho course fast for the Vincent Jockey Club's Meeting. Results: —•

Ophir Hack Handicap, £105; 6 furlongs.—l Green Gables, 7.9 (Spratt), 1; 2 Confidant, 7.1, 2; 4 Papeete, 7.7, 3. Scr.: Craiglea, Astaire, Taxpayer, Slamannan. Two lengths; head. Time, lmin 15 4-ssec.

Matakanui Handicap, £105; 6 furlongs.—l Craiglea, 7.11 (Spratt), 1; 2 Master Hotspur, 7.9, 2. The only starters. Three, lengths. Time, lmin 16sec.
